We are seeking an experienced Electronics Engineer to join a cutting-edge space and advanced engineering organisation developing high-reliability electronic systems for space-grade applications. This role sits within a multidisciplinary team working on complex hardware where performance, robustness, and traceability are critical.

You will be responsible for the design, test, and verification of electronic subsystems, with a strong emphasis on deep-level fault finding down to component level and hands-on laboratory work supporting development and qualification activities.

Required Skills & Experience
  • Proven experience as an Electronics Engineer in a high-reliability or aerospace/space environment
  • Strong fault-finding skills with the ability to troubleshoot down to component level (resistors, ICs, PCB traces, etc.)
  • Hands-on experience with electronic test, measurement, and debugging equipment
  • Proficiency in Python for instrument control, automation, and data acquisition
  • Solid understanding of analogue and digital circuit design principles
  • Experience with PCB-level diagnostics and electronic system validation
  • Strong analytical and problem-solving skills in complex hardware environments
  • Excellent communication skills and ability to work in a collaborative engineering team
